Exchange 2010
2 servers in the DAG group
TSM 6.3.3 server on Win2K8
Full backups of the Exchange DB's done on weekends, incrementals on weekdays.
We normally back up 3 TB in 7 hours, no problem.
Trying to restore a 1.4 GB mailbox to a .pst file
On the FCM window, the DUR value has not changed at all.
The session has been running for 50 minutes.
A Q SESSION looks like this:
49,146 Tcp/Ip IdleW 47.4 M 21.8 K 761 Node
?? USA-DAG1 (USMX3_EXC)
49,147 Tcp/Ip Run 0 S 4.4 M 276.6 K Node
?? USA-DAG1 (USMX3)
The entire 50 minutes, the backup has been in the RUN state, and only
transferred 4.4 MB. Has not called for a tape. (The last full will be on
tape, incrementals might be in the disk pool. Or not.)
I'm not even sure I believe the 4.4 MB.
So WHAT is it doing in the RUN state for 50 minutes?
Will it ever finish?
